A New Look with John & Yoko

Going Japanese with cosmopolitan restaurant John & Yoko takes on a whole new meaning with its interior update and menu revamp. After 8 years as the beloved choice in Greenbelt 5 for Makati diners looking for an upscale dining experience, the upgrade stirs things up in bold and exciting ways. John & Yoko introduced urban cuisine in the tradition of Japanese restaurants found in cities like Madrid, Rome, Paris, and of course, New York.

Restaurateur and Sumo Sam Restaurant Concepts Group honcho Ricky Laudico says, “Filipinos have developed a more discriminating palate for Japanese food, from the freshness of their sushi and sashimi, the crispness of their tempura, the umami of their ramen. Cosmopolitan cuisine has also evolved from urban and trendy into more sophisticated gastronomy with global appeal. John & Yoko takes it up a notch with a new look that appeals to a wider crowd, and a more interesting menu for a truly unique flavor experience.”

Bold playfulness

The menu revamp involved much more than adding new dishes and taking out old ones. To bring a truly unique experience to its clients, three top chefs put their heads together. Former Nobu New York and Shibuya Las Vegas chef and John & Yoko head Chef Chris Oronce is a rising star in the Philippines for Japanese cuisine, and uniquely positioned to infuse a bold playfulness into the dishes.  He says.“We’ve infused bolder flavors into the menu for some interesting flavor combinations, and employed some new techniques on the bestsellers to bring out more flavors,”

Chef Benjamin “Bengon” Gonzales contributes a touch of tradition to the endeavor, bringing to the fore his years of experience with the cuisine, and his Torigin and Furosato training.  He says, “The dishes showcase different culinary traditions, both Asian and Western, with premium ingredients and sauces that offer new flavor profiles.”

Mix in the innovative techniques favored by Chef Sonny Mariano, who has won numerous international competitions help in Singapore and Malaysia, and you are sure to have a winning combination.  He says, “There are more textures on the menu now, with components that add that extra crunch or creaminess, so you can savor each mouthful. Several dishes also showcase a combination of temperatures, with both hot and cold components.”

Menu rundown

Some of the stars of the menu include Salmon Carpaccio, and Truffle Prawns in Asparagus. Healthy choices feature Spicy Tuna Salad, Salmon Lasagna, and Unagi Chocolate. Must-tries are The Salmon Aburi with Mango Salsa and The Dragon Roll. You should also check out  the selection of Mini Tacos in Crab,  Tuna, and Salmon, or even the Scallop Dynamite, Oyster Overload, and Crispy Chicken Teriyaki. Other selections include Uni Truffle Pizza. The Euro Soba , and the Shoyu Chasyu Ramen.

For heavier fare, the Chicken and Shrimp Japaella is sure to please, while the slow-cooked Braised Buta Kakuni and the Ropponggi Steak goes down very well. For dessert, you cannot go wrong with the Dessert Bento, a cacophony of different crepes.

Chef Chris says, “At the heart of each dish is still the well-loved classic. The new dishes are simply exciting takes on old favorites, and we hope our guests find a new favorite dish on the menu.”

The fun has just begun.  John & Yoko is set to roll out even more dishes in the future. Chef Sonny explains, “We’ve decided to update the menu every so often so there’s always something to look forward to. It’s going to be exciting for the diners of the restaurant.”
